Earlier today, I posted an interview with Malcolm David Kelley, who is starring in the upcoming Kathryn Bigelow film, Detroit. Annapurna Pictures also released a really great video along with the second trailer for the film where we get to hear from several of the people who lived through the events depicted in the film, including Melvin Dismukes (played by John Boyega in the film) all stressing how important it is that this story finally get told.
